I've been doing a lot of summer fruits coming in from Chile, their
summer
our winter. The fruit is starting to export in, and let me tell
you something, the apricots aren't that bad. I remember a few years ago
if they came in from Chile I'd rather eat a lemon, but look at this.
They have some nice color to them, a translucent orange all the way
around and a little bit of a red or purple tinge to them, which is
good. That means they have a nice sweetness inside them and they have a
little soft give to the touch, which is the way you're supposed to
select an apricot.

It's been a year and a half since I wrote about the impending closure of Marjorie, divulging Donna Moodie's plans to relocate her Belltown bistro and bar after the building that housed it was sold. "When I found out I had to move, I felt really devastated," she said at the time. "But then I looked around and saw it was a great opportunity, too." At year's end, opportunity knocked, and plans are now underway to recreate Marjorie in a new space adjacent to the Chloe Apartments on Capitol Hill. Sure, the site isn't everything Donna wanted when she was dreaming of her next move, but in this economy, she says, it's got everything she needs.
